Almost everyone expects big things from the Cavs

by Pat McManamon on October 14, 2009

in Cavs, McManamon

Like almost everyone, Charley Rosen of Fox predicts big things for the Cavs.

He lists many positives, then has this among the negatives: “There was a palpable arrogance that pervaded last season's team that could be equally as fateful if it lingers.”

I said it before, and I’ll say it again: The Cavs were not an arrogant team on the court last season. They did goofy stuff off the court, but on the court they respected the game and their opponent. In fact, I’d say shortly after the season ended they were very much a humbled team.

Rosen’s conclusion: “Primed for a serious run to dethrone the Lakers. This time, the Cavs will have no legitimate excuses should they fail
